    We’re looking for a highly organized and proactive Legal Administrative Assistant to support a dynamic legal team working collaboratively across the department. This role is critical in ensuring the smooth operation of legal functions by managing day-to-day administrative tasks, coordinating communications, and maintaining confidentiality in a fast-paced corporate environment.

    The person in this position will:

    + Manage calendars, schedule meetings, and coordinate travel arrangements for the Chief Legal Officer and legal team.

    + Prepare, edit, and format legal documents, correspondence, reports, and presentations.

    + Track and process legal invoices, expense reports, and budget documentation.

    + Maintain legal files and records, ensuring accuracy and confidentiality.

    + Support litigation and compliance processes, including document collection and coordination with internal and external counsel.

    + Receive and route service of process documents and assist with case assignments.

    + Respond to internal inquiries regarding legal policies, procedures, and compliance matters.

    + Assist with onboarding and coordination of outside counsel and legal vendors.

    + Organize and support team meetings, including agenda preparation and note-taking.

    + Serve as a liaison between the legal department and other corporate functions.

    + Receive service of process and assign cases to in-house and outside counsel.

    + Maintain our legal database, which includes coding and describing matters, troubleshooting billing issues, and regularly updating the matters.

    + Manage outside counsel with managing monthly accruals and tracking legal spend by matter type for reporting.

    + Provide quarterly accruals to the accounting department.

    + Review and process payment for monthly invoices and restitution cases including utilizing eBuilder system to ensure timely payment.

    + Provide monthly reporting on various metrics, including spend and status of employment and other matters.

    + May assist with collection of discovery documentation for outside counsel and/or drafting or proofing of discovery responses.
